悠悠楠杉
防红源码深度解析:构建安全、高效的网络系统
防红源码全解
标题:
防红源码深度解析:构建安全、高效的网络系统
关键词:
- 防红源码
- 网络安全性
- 代码审计
- 漏洞修复
- 入侵检测
- 加密技术
- 访问控制
- 防火墙配置
- 事件响应计划
- 网络安全策略
描述:
在当今的数字时代,网络安全已经成为企业及个人用户不可忽视的重要议题。其中,“防红”(即防止网络攻击中的“红色警报”事件)更是重中之重。本文旨在通过全面的源码分析、策略制定及技术实施,为构建一个安全、高效的网络系统提供详尽的指导。从代码审计到漏洞修复,从入侵检测到访问控制,每一步都需谨慎操作,确保系统免受黑客攻击。同时,本文还将探讨加密技术、防火墙配置等关键环节,并制定合理的事件响应计划,以应对可能发生的网络安全事件。
正文:
1. 代码审计与漏洞修复
代码审计是发现并修复潜在安全漏洞的第一步。通过静态代码分析工具和人工审查相结合的方式,对所有源代码进行全面检查。确保关键函数、数据传输、认证机制等关键环节无漏洞。一旦发现漏洞,应立即采取措施进行修复,并记录修复过程及结果,为后续的审计和改进提供依据。
2. 入侵检测系统(IDS)与预防
部署入侵检测系统是防红的重要一环。IDS能够实时监控网络流量和系统日志,识别并响应异常行为。这包括但不限于异常登录尝试、数据泄露尝试等。通过建立白名单、黑名单机制和规则集,可以更有效地识别潜在威胁,并采取相应措施进行阻止或报警。此外,定期更新和优化IDS规则库也是必不可少的。
3. 访问控制与身份验证
实施严格的访问控制策略是防止未经授权访问的关键。这包括但不限于:使用多因素身份验证(MFA)来增强用户身份的认证强度;限制用户权限,确保每个用户只能访问其工作所必需的资源;定期审查和更新用户权限,确保不会因权限过时或误操作而造成安全风险。
4. 加密技术的应用
数据在传输和存储过程中的加密是保护数据免受窃取和篡改的重要手段。应使用强加密算法(如AES-256)对敏感数据进行加密,并确保加密密钥的安全管理。此外,还应采用SSL/TLS协议来保护数据在传输过程中的安全。
5. 防火墙配置与策略管理
防火墙是网络的第一道防线,其配置的合理性和策略的准确性直接关系到整个网络的安全性。应确保防火墙规则能够阻止已知的攻击模式和潜在威胁,同时允许合法的网络通信。定期检查和更新防火墙规则集,以适应新的安全威胁和业务需求的变化。
6. 事件响应计划与培训
制定详细的事件响应计划是应对网络安全事件的关键。该计划应包括不同类型安全事件的应急流程、通信机制、资源调配等细节。同时,定期对员工进行网络安全培训,提高其安全意识和应对能力,也是必不可少的。通过模拟演练等形式,检验并改进响应计划的执行效果。
7. 网络安全策略与合规性
制定全面的网络安全策略,并确保其符合行业标准和法律法规的要求(如GDPR、HIPAA等)。这包括但不限于数据保护、隐私政策、访问控制等方面的规定。此外,定期进行合规性审查和审计,确保所有操作均符合规定要求。
通过上述措施的全面实施和持续优化,可以显著提高网络系统的安全性,降低遭受网络攻击的风险。防红源码的全面解析与实施不仅需要技术手段的支持,更需有严谨的流程管理和持续的改进意识。只有这样,才能构建一个安全、高效的网络环境。